International Triennial of Tapestry Starts May 9 in Łódź

2016-05-02 by Aleksandr Shatskih

15th International Triennial of Tapestry, Łódź 2016

Coming to Łódź May 9th, the 15th International Triennial of Tapestry is the oldest, biggest and most prestigious
exhibition promoting contemporary fiber art. Running through October at the Central Museum of Textiles, the exhibition is also one of the most unique events in Europe.

Chania market reopening 2026

€1.5 Million Lifeline for Chania Municipal Market Businesses Ahead of 2026 Reopening

2026-04-16 By Iorgos Pappas

After years of scaffolding, dust, and the occasional existential crisis, the Municipal Market of Chania (Δημοτική Αγορά Χανίων) is preparing for a meaningful comeback. Through coordinated institutional efforts, €1.5 million in funding has been secured to provide immediate support to approximately 50 local professionals whose businesses were disrupted by the extensive reconstruction works.
